在区块链技术迅猛发展的今天,钱包的安全性显得尤为重要。作为一种新兴的数字资产钱包,TPWallet因其多功能及便捷性受到众多用户的青睐。然而,TPWallet在合约授权方面潜藏着一定的风险。本文将深入探讨TPWallet合约授权的风险、影响及相应的防范措施,从而帮助用户更好地保护自身资产安全。

TPWallet合约授权的基本概念

合约授权是指用户通过数字钱包对某项合约进行的授权行为。通过这种授权,用户的资产可以在合约约定的条件下被管理、使用或转移。在TPWallet中,用户可以通过授权直接与智能合约进行交互,这种方式大大提高了交易的效率与便捷性。

合约授权的潜在危险

尽管合约授权为用户提供了极大的便利,但同时也存在一系列的风险,包括但不限于以下几个方面:

  • 未经过审查的合约:许多用户在进行合约授权时,往往并没有对合约进行仔细审查,导致授权给黑客或恶意合约,进而造成资产损失。
  • 权限过度授权:一些用户在授权时为了便捷,可能会给予合约过多的权限,例如全额转移,这样一旦合约被攻击,资产将面临极大风险。
  • 合约漏洞利用:智能合约本身可能存在代码漏洞,黑客通过这些漏洞可以未经授权就访问或转移用户资金。
  • 缺乏安全意识:部分用户对合约授权流程不够了解,缺乏必要的安全措施,例如两步验证等,导致安全隐患。

合约授权的风险分析

具体来说,TPWallet的合约授权风险主要体现在以下几个方面:

  • 合约安全性:在众多合约中,有许多是未经审计的,存在严重的安全隐患。用户若不认真甄别,极易将资金暴露在安全风险之下。
  • 用户习惯:一些用户在进行合约授权时,不会认真阅读合约条款,轻率地允许合约管理其资金。这样的行为在不知情的情况下,将可能导致巨额资金的损失。
  • 合约的不可逆性:区块链的交易一旦确认将无法撤回,因此一旦用户授权了恶意合约,资金便可能一去不复返。
  • 市场监管缺失:当前市场对合约的监管相对松散,缺乏有效的监管措施,使得不良合约和诈骗合约横行,给用户的资产造成损失。

防范合约授权风险的有效措施

为了有效降低TPWallet合约授权的风险,用户可以采取以下几种防范措施:

  • 认真审查合约:在进行合约授权前,用户应仔细评估合约的来源及安全性,优先选择经过认证的合约。
  • 限制授权权限:用户应谨慎设置合约授权权限,尽量避免给予合约完全管理权限,以减少资产面临的风险。
  • 增强安全意识:增强用户的安全意识,定期学习关于合约授权和区块链安全的知识,提高自身防范能力。
  • 使用安全工具:利用一些安全工具,例如合约安全审计工具,可以帮助用户识别合约的潜在风险。

相关问题分析

1. 如何识别危险的合约?

识别危险合约的关键在于了解合约的基本特征、源头和历史记录。以下是几个识别危险合约的步骤:

  • 检查合约来源:合约是否来自可靠的源头,是否经过社区或专业机构的审计。
  • 评估合约的历史记录:查看合约的交易历史,是否存在异常情况,如频繁的转账,或大额资金转移。
  • 了解合约的功能和机制:用户要懂得合约的具体功能,是否与其声称的用途相符。
  • 使用合约审核工具:借助一些智能合约审计工具,对合约进行安全性分析,识别潜在漏洞。

2. 我该如何管理我的授权权限?

管理授权权限是保护资产的一项重要措施,用户可以采取以下策略:

  • 分层授权:根据不同的需求,将合约的授权权限分层,仅授权必要的权限,其他权限保持关闭状态。
  • 定期检查授权状态:定期查看已授权合约的状态,及时撤回不再需要或可疑的合约授权。
  • 设定限额:在可能的情况下,为合约授权设定每日或每次交易的金额限制,控制潜在风险。
  • 学习双重签名等安全措施:运用双重签名和多重授权的机制,提高资产安全性。

3. 一旦授权恶意合约该怎么办?

如果用户已经误授权了恶意合约,应立即采取措施:

  • 撤回授权:第一时间在钱包中撤回对恶意合约的授权,以防止资金被转移。
  • 改变受影响账户的安全设置:更新相关的密码和安全设置,确保账户不再次受到侵害。
  • 报警和投诉:如果资产已经被转移,及时向相应的执法机构报警,尽量追回损失。
  • 学习并总结教训:认真分析此次事件,总结经验教训,提升自身的安全防范意识。

4. 我如何保护我的线上资产安全?

保护线上资产安全的措施多种多样,用户应综合考虑多方面的防护:

  • 使用硬件钱包:选择硬件钱包进行冷存储,避免长时间在线时资产暴露在潜在风险下。
  • 开启两步验证功能:为钱包和交易所账户开启两步验证,加强多重身份验证阻止未授权访问。
  • 改进密码安全:设置复杂密码,定期更换密码,并使用密码管理器保存各类密码。
  • 关注网络安全:保持对网络环境的警惕,不随意点击可疑链接或下载不明软件。

总之,在进行TPWallet合约授权时,用户需时刻保持警惕,加强自身对合约及区块链安全的理解,从而确保资产的安全。只有通过良好的管理习惯和安全意识,才能有效降低合约授权带来的风险。